Make Your Own Pizza Program
Where/When: North Bellmore Public Library; Friday, July 29 from 4:30 to 5:30 p.m.
Why Go: Drop your tween or teen off for this fun filled event where everyone will make their own pizza from scratch. A great way for those young chefs to try out their food preparation technique. Participants will make the dough, add sauce and sprinkle cheese on a delicious pizza that can be baked at home.
Pricing: Free. Call the library at (516) 785-6260 to register.

Passport to Fun at Michaels: Brazil
Where/When: Michaels in Levittown; Saturday, July 30 from 11 a.m. to 2 p.m.
Why Go: Bring your kids around the world and back in one afternoon at Michaels. As part of the “Passport to Fun” program, this event will focus on Brazilian culture. Children will have a chance to make a Carnival mask and snake craft. For kids over the age of three, please.
Pricing: Free while supplies last.
